Ai Jo�o, o lance � o seguinte: Eu tamb�m uso o JDeveloper9i, mas n�o
depuro ou uso o Tomcat ligado junto com a ferramenta, JAVA_OPTS pode conter
qualquer par�metro que voc� desejar passar para o Tomcat como por exemplo o
comando para que a virtual machine use m�moria compartilhada ( remote
debugging ) assim voc� poder� depurar seus programas de qualquer m�quina,
at� aqui tudo bem. O que realmente lhe interessa � conseguir depurar as
p�ginas JSP, quando o Tomcat cria, compila ou simplesmente carrega a p�gina
esta esta em sua JVM, ent�o n�o existe nenhum problema em mandar a ordem
para criar o breakpoint na p�gina JSP, no diret�rio work � onde os fontes e
bin�rios das p�ginas s�o armazenados, consulte a documneta��o do JDB para
saber como funciona o esquema da depura��o remota, l� voc� vai encontrar o
comando que deve ser colocado dentro do JAVA_OPTS. Qualquer coisa d� um
grito ai.
